case 4586 - fuck it, everything is interdependent, just went for it, mostly buildable just reporting to fixup then testing after this
This commit is contained in:
@@ -22,7 +22,7 @@ namespace AyaNova.Api.Controllers
|
||||
/// Authentication controller
|
||||
/// </summary>
|
||||
[ApiController]
|
||||
[ApiVersion("8.0")]
|
||||
[Asp.Versioning.ApiVersion("8.0")]
|
||||
[Route("api/v{version:apiVersion}/auth")]
|
||||
[Produces("application/json")]
|
||||
[Authorize]
|
||||
@@ -492,7 +492,7 @@ namespace AyaNova.Api.Controllers
|
||||
/// <param name="apiVersion">From route path</param>
|
||||
/// <returns>New concurrency code</returns>
|
||||
[HttpPost("request-reset-password/{id}")]
|
||||
public async Task<IActionResult> SendPasswordResetCode([FromRoute] long id, ApiVersion apiVersion)
|
||||
public async Task<IActionResult> SendPasswordResetCode([FromRoute] long id, Asp.Versioning.ApiVersion apiVersion)
|
||||
{
|
||||
//Note: this is not allowed for an anonymous users because it's only intended for now to work for staff user's who will send the request on behalf of the User
|
||||
if (!serverState.IsOpen)
|
||||
@@ -525,7 +525,7 @@ namespace AyaNova.Api.Controllers
|
||||
/// <param name="apiVersion">From route path</param>
|
||||
/// <returns>Authentication app activation code</returns>
|
||||
[HttpGet("totp")]
|
||||
public async Task<IActionResult> GenerateAndSendTOTP(ApiVersion apiVersion)
|
||||
public async Task<IActionResult> GenerateAndSendTOTP(Asp.Versioning.ApiVersion apiVersion)
|
||||
{
|
||||
if (!serverState.IsOpen)
|
||||
return StatusCode(503, new ApiErrorResponse(serverState.ApiErrorCode, null, serverState.Reason));
|
||||
@@ -578,7 +578,7 @@ namespace AyaNova.Api.Controllers
|
||||
/// <param name="apiVersion">From route path</param>
|
||||
/// <returns>OK on success</returns>
|
||||
[HttpPost("totp-validate")]
|
||||
public async Task<IActionResult> ValidateTOTP([FromBody] TFAPinParam pin, ApiVersion apiVersion)
|
||||
public async Task<IActionResult> ValidateTOTP([FromBody] TFAPinParam pin, Asp.Versioning.ApiVersion apiVersion)
|
||||
{
|
||||
if (!serverState.IsOpen)
|
||||
return StatusCode(503, new ApiErrorResponse(serverState.ApiErrorCode, null, serverState.Reason));
|
||||
@@ -637,7 +637,7 @@ namespace AyaNova.Api.Controllers
|
||||
/// <param name="apiVersion">From route path</param>
|
||||
/// <returns>OK on success</returns>
|
||||
[HttpPost("totp-disable/{id}")]
|
||||
public async Task<IActionResult> DisableTOTP([FromRoute] long id, ApiVersion apiVersion)
|
||||
public async Task<IActionResult> DisableTOTP([FromRoute] long id, Asp.Versioning.ApiVersion apiVersion)
|
||||
{
|
||||
if (!serverState.IsOpen)
|
||||
return StatusCode(503, new ApiErrorResponse(serverState.ApiErrorCode, null, serverState.Reason));
|
||||
|
||||
Reference in New Issue
Block a user